Where does oven vent go?

Where does oven vent go? The oven is vented through a duct under the right rear surface unit, and will release heat when either the oven or broiler is in use. This will cause that area of your cooktop to feel warm and may even seem to be turned on. This duct needs to be cleaned frequently.

Where does stove vent go? Range hoods are vented up through the roof or out through an exterior wall. Look for a metal duct going through the cabinets above or an exhaust cap on the exterior wall behind the range hood. You should feel air being blown out of the exhaust cap on the roof or wall when the fan is running.

Do range hoods have to be vented outside? Range hoods do not have to be vented to the outside. … But, ducted range hoods are almost always preferred over ductless hoods. They remove all the smoke and cooking exhaust from your kitchen, while ductless hoods recirculate your cooking exhaust back into your kitchen.

Where does kitchen vent air go? Downdraft range hoods are fans installed behind your kitchen range. They suck the air down into a duct or inside the vent through filters. Then the air recirculates back into your kitchen. Many downdraft ranges can be lifted out of your kitchen range and set back in place when you’re not cooking.

Are volcanic vents a mineral on the seafloor?

Ocean vents are surrounded by seafloor massive sulfide (SMS) deposits. SMS deposits are minerals that harden as vent fluid interacts with seawater. SMS deposits can be material left over from collapsed chimneys or even chimneys themselves. They contain metals such as copper, iron, zinc, lead, silver, and gold.

What is the vent in my ceiling for?

Answer: Ceiling vents allow air to pass through the attic and out through vents in the roof. When the cooler kicks on, the ceiling vent is automatically opened by the barometric damper responding to the air pressure change. When the cooler turns off, damper closes automatically.

Does a bathroom fan need to be vented?

Bathroom fan installation requires outside ventilation. … Letting the fan exhaust into an open attic will cause moisture buildup on the underside of the roof. Avoid venting through a soffit vent or ridge vent.

Can you vent two bathrooms together?

Well, you can’t! You’d often blow air from one bathroom into the other, and local building inspectors wouldn’t approve it. But while you can’t have two fans with one vent, you can make one fan and one vent serve two bathrooms. … A grille in each bathroom attaches to ducts, which then fasten to a “Y” connector at the fan.

How are toilets vented?

Vents are simply pipes connected to all your toilets, tub drains, and sinks and leads to the outside of your home through the roof. When these vents are clogged, the system is not equalized making it difficult for wastewater to flow freely.
